M287 LAT is a 1995 Daihatsu Charade in Blue with a 1,295c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 52.4%.
Across all 1995 Daihatsu Charade models, the average MOT pass rate is 68.3% with a typical mileage of 64,168 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Daihatsu Charade f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 5,998 recorded failures. If you're considering buying M287 LAT, it's worth having these areas checked by a mechanic before committing.
The Daihatsu Charade typically stays on UK roads for around 36 years. At 31 years old, this Daihatsu Charade is approaching the upper end of the typical lifespan for this model.
